js 数组与数据处理技巧
百科精选
2025-04-27 20:55:08
导读 在前端开发中,JavaScript(简称JS)数组是一种非常常见的数据结构,用于存储有序的数据集合。无论是简单的数值列表还是复杂的对象数组,数...
在前端开发中,JavaScript(简称JS)数组是一种非常常见的数据结构,用于存储有序的数据集合。无论是简单的数值列表还是复杂的对象数组,数组都能高效地帮助开发者完成数据操作。然而,如何更优雅、高效地使用数组进行数据处理,是每个开发者需要掌握的技能。
首先,数组提供了丰富的内置方法,如`map()`、`filter()`和`reduce()`等。这些方法不仅简化了代码逻辑,还提高了代码的可读性和复用性。例如,通过`map()`可以轻松将数组中的每个元素转换为另一种形式;借助`filter()`可以筛选出符合条件的元素;而`reduce()`则能够将数组聚合为单一值,常用于统计或计算。
其次,对于大规模数据的处理,掌握一些高级技巧至关重要。比如,利用`Array.prototype.flat()`可以快速扁平化多维数组,避免繁琐的手动循环;结合ES6的解构赋值,可以方便地从数组中提取所需数据。此外,结合现代浏览器对性能优化的支持,合理运用这些技术能显著提升应用效率。
总之,熟练掌握JS数组及其相关方法,不仅能提高开发效率,还能让代码更加简洁优雅,是每位前端工程师必备的基本功之一。